Hannes Gumz
Within the scope of his dissertation Hannes Gumz is working on the synthesis of amphiphilic block copolymers for the formation of responsive polymersomes. These polymersomes should be applied as nanocarriers for the guided transport of substances and information. The project is part of the "Chemical Information Processing"-path of the cfAED (center for advancing electronics Dresden).
Fields of Activity
- Controlled radical polymerisation techniques for the synthesis of functional amphiphilic blockcopolymers
- Polymer characterisation by NMR and SEC
- Polymersome formation by self-assembly methods and characterisation by DLS, CryoTEM and UV/Vis-Spectroscopy
